Shute’s Lane near the village of Symondsbury in Dorset. The walls of this ancient holloway, or sunken lane, are some 10 metres below the surrounding landscape, the trail worn away after centuries of passing boots, hooves and cartwheels. Most of the sandstone walls are extensively carved in a varying array of graffiti, including elaborate Celtic patterns, ghouls and gargoyles, a practice that seems to have been ongoing for decades.
